Preparing for a New Puppy
Bringing a puppy home requires preparation because the first few weeks often influence how comfortably the animal adjusts to a new environment. A suitable sleeping area, food and water bowls, safe toys, grooming supplies, and appropriate identification should be prepared before arrival. Families should also establish household routines for feeding, toilet training, exercise, and rest. Early socialisation is another important part of raising a confident companion. Puppies benefit from carefully managed exposure to household sounds, different people, appropriate environments, and other healthy animals. Training should remain consistent without becoming overly demanding, particularly while a young puppy is still developing. Considering Lifestyle and Long-Term Responsibilities
Every dog has individual needs, even when it belongs to a breed known for particular characteristics. Potential owners should therefore consider daily schedules, access to outdoor areas, preferred activities, and the amount of interaction available throughout the day. Doodle-type dogs can be social and intelligent, meaning mental stimulation can be just as valuable as physical exercise. Interactive play, training exercises, controlled walks, and suitable enrichment activities may help prevent boredom. A household that understands these responsibilities before adoption or purchase is generally better positioned to provide consistency, companionship, and appropriate care throughout a dog’s life.
Grooming should also be included in long-term planning. Dogs with particular coat types may require regular brushing to reduce tangling and professional grooming depending on coat length and condition. Veterinary appointments, preventative healthcare, balanced nutrition, dental care, exercise, and routine monitoring all contribute to general wellbeing. Prospective owners should also understand that no breed is completely free from health concerns, making appropriate health checks and responsible breeding practices important considerations.
